In some section, The Old Drift explores technology's impact on society through various futuristic elements, such as embedded chips called "Beads" that connect individuals to information networks, blurring the lines between human and machine. The narrative features innovations like drones and viral vaccines, reflecting Zambia's technological evolution while addressing contemporary issues like colonialism and health crises. 

In The Old Drift, drones and microdrones serve as symbols of technological advancement and surveillance, reflecting societal changes.

The Zambian space program, initiated by Edward Makuka Nkoloso in the 1960s, aimed to launch a rocket carrying 17-year-old Matha Mwambwa and two cats to the Moon. Nkoloso sought to position Zambia as a contender in the Space Race against the U.S. and Soviet Union. Training involved unconventional methods like rolling trainees in oil drums to simulate weightlessness.

Yesterday’s update

Started with kazagame at Atmosphere—a vibe. Later, hit up an art exhibition at the studio. The artist’s style? Unique. No canvas, no paint—just fabric. Every piece stitched together like a story. Price tag? A cool 120,000 Birr each.

Clever concept: He doesn’t paint; he stitches.

It sparked a thought. 📖 Recently read something about Ethiopia's textile industry, and here’s the jaw-dropper: In the past 10 years, Ethiopia’s entire textile and apparel sector has exported roughly $1 billion.

For perspective: EpicGame's Fortnite racks up 3x that amount selling virtual clothing. Per year? They pull in $3.6 billion USD.

Fortnite makes 3x money in a year selling virtual clothing as Ethiopia does physical cloths in Decade.

Real cloth vs. virtual skins.
Atoms vs. bits.
